PARK RAPIDS — An inadvertent whistle wiped out a key East Grand Forks Senior High touchdown right before halftime.

It didn't matter.

The Green Wave opened the second half with a flurry and beat Park Rapids 37-24 on Friday, Sept. 12, for their first victory of the season.

"I'm really excited for the guys," Green Wave coach Ryan Kasowski said. "I'm happy for them. They put in a lot of work every week. There are still a lot of things we can clean up. Any time you get a win, you never take it for granted. Winning is hard. We want our guys to celebrate this and come back to work next week ready to get another one."
